Output 31ef32d98a5ccc8548e8cc98262ba45bc3f17cc360800a4afcea11cad7a56b70:0

value
1493847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 583758e8f92d7b4eb0efec019dfa02f629bbb68d OP_EQUAL
address
39jTh2HbkyyNssvFXZ9UEwbmtCjsiJhPqk
transaction
31ef32d98a5ccc8548e8cc98262ba45bc3f17cc360800a4afcea11cad7a56b70
confirmations
201474
spent
true